Services

The property benefits from mains electricity, a private water supply, and oil fired central heating. Drainage is to a septic tank. The Land benefits from a natural water supply only.

Please note we have not been able to test services or make any judgement on their current condition. Prospective Purchasers should make their own enquiries.

In particular, the septic tank has not been surveyed and may not comply with new regulations ‘General Binding Rules’ (effective 1st January 2020) enforced by the Environment Agency. It is the responsibility of the Prospective Purchaser to ensure that a compliant system is in place at their own cost as per legislation.
